3.0 out of 5 stars A good sample, but not dual language, September 22, 2007
By 
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Treasury of Arabic Love Poems, Quotations & Proverbs: In Arabic and English (Hardcover)
The scope of poetry is this book's greatest attribute, covering works from 554 to the present, with poets from throughout the Arabic-speaking world. The poetry itself in translation is beautiful; the imagery, metaphors and sense of place and time all uniquely Arabic.

I give it three stars, however, because of the transliteration of the Arabic, and the quotations and proverbs, both of which I felt detracted from the book's strengths. I can understand why the original Arabic would not be included (what would be the point for non-readers (or speakers of Arabic), the need for a transliteration is lost on me. Similarly, the quotations and proverbs, while written about the topic of love, paled in comparison to the poetry.

If you are interested in Arabic poetry, I recommend Nizar Kabbani's _Arabian Love Poems_.
